Hudson's Puzzle Series Vol. 3: Sudoku is still occupying my main gaming time. My performance is steadily improving, but if I make a mistake, 10 minutes will be lost due to backtracking.

Hudson's Puzzle Series Vol 3: Sudoku (normal) My performance up to board 115

This time I have completed up to 115 on the normal. Only 25 boards to go on Normal then I will be onto Difficult. I already completed the Silver challenge with ease. It was unlocked at the 70th Normal board. Now there's only Gold and Platinum to unlock.

I improved my best time from 11:03 to 7:53 (yes!). But average time just doesn't want to go under 20 minutes. Last time it was 28:59 @ 41, and this time it is 24:28.

I did figure out a newer sub-strategy involving a row of 3 and non-same row element pushing to the other side to that row. I won't bother explaining it because it's probably a well-known one. Why is it only the advanced techniques are figured out when the pressure is on?
